Quarterly Planning Note — Divestiture of the Coastal Tooling Unit

For the finance team: the sale of the Coastal Tooling unit to Pellmark Industries remains on track for close in Q3. Please finalize the carve-out balance sheet, reconcile intercompany positions, and prepare the working-capital adjustment schedule by month-end. Audit support requests should be prioritized. For planning purposes, note the following sensitive item:

internal memo for hawef-kahif: The finance team signed off on a budget of $25.9 million for Project Sorox. The renewal with Pelokek Logistics closes at $51.7 million a year, 52 percent below the last contract.

## Configuration

Tethra's payment retry layer derives idempotency keys by HMAC-ing the order ID, attempt window, and tenant salt, so duplicate retries are rejected server-side. Keys expire after 24 hours and are never logged. Rotation requires a dual-write window of one hour. The HMAC secret must be set on the following line.

sealed setting: ARCHIVE_KEY3=8d0

## Deploying the Gatewick Proctor Queue

Deploys are pretty painless: push to main, wait for the pipeline, then watch the queue drain dashboard for five minutes. If candidates pile up mid-exam, roll back first and ask questions later — the queue replays safely. Everything the workers care about lives in one config block, shown here for reference.

settings of bafof-yagef:
JOROX_PIN=8740
JOROX_TENANT=pelox
JOROX_METRICS_HOST=metrics.jorox.qorvelworks.internal
JOROX_SEAL=seal_c78f63c1
JOROX_STANDBY_TEAM=norax

The Slatewing component library follows strict semver; only patch releases auto-publish, while minor and major bumps require a steward approval in the release pipeline. If consumers report broken builds after a publish, check whether a minor change shipped with an incorrect patch tag — that's the most common failure. To remediate, deprecate the bad version and publish a corrected one; never unpublish. The deprecation procedure and version-pinning guidance are documented on the internal page below.

wiki page, hahif-hahif: https://argocd.kelvisys.corp/browse/board/settings/pages/1442e0b1065d83f1